Output 6855736318fd761d20b4b85e0c6d0a1751a603269e2f18705c693b9292fce0c0:3

value
9988806
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d915c38a81bba591d7dc03ca86d95107b2e0b642d08ea9406f5addeb03192d92
address
tb1pmy2u8z5phwjer47uq09gdk23q7ewpdjz6z82jsr0ttw7kqce9kfq4d7a30
transaction
6855736318fd761d20b4b85e0c6d0a1751a603269e2f18705c693b9292fce0c0
confirmations
81062
spent
true